Kris Schiele is a leading figure in combinatorial materials science, with a specialized focus on the high-throughput development of marine fouling-release coatings. Her research bridges the gap between rapid materials synthesis and efficient performance screening, enabling the accelerated discovery of novel surface technologies. Her most cited work, from 2007, introduces an automated spinning water jet apparatus designed for the high-throughput characterization of fouling-release marine coatings. This innovation directly addresses a critical bottleneck in the field: the need for rapid, reliable assays to evaluate and down-select from the vast libraries of coating compositions generated by combinatorial methods. By automating the assessment of surface fouling release, Schiele’s apparatus has become a foundational tool, cited 46 times and enabling researchers to systematically identify promising coating candidates with unprecedented speed. Her contributions are pivotal for advancing durable, environmentally friendly marine coatings, demonstrating how clever engineering of screening methods can accelerate the translation of materials discovery into real-world applications.
